Questa regola genera un avviso nel caso in cui uno o più moduli di Monitoraggio eccezioni senza agenti (AEM) riscontrino un parametro in un gruppo di errori contenente caratteri considerati invalidi da AEM.
Per un gruppo di errori AEM ha riscontrato un parametro contenente caratteri considerati non validi da AEM; questo gruppo di report verrà pertanto spostato nella cartella Dati non validi della condivisione file.
AEM ha riscontrato un parametro per un gruppo di errori contenente caratteri considerati non validi da AEM: ~!@#$^&*()=+[]{}|;`",<>/?. Le informazioni sul gruppo di errori e sul parametro sono disponibili negli eventi e avvisi associati.
Se il parametro/gruppo di errori è valido, aggiungere il nome parametro all'elenco delle cartelle delle eccezioni tramite la classe SDK: Microsoft.EnterpriseManagement.Monitoring.ClientMonitoring.AemGlobalSettings. Al termine, copiare i dati dalle cartelle InvalidData\Cabs, InvalidData\Counts alle cartelle Cabs e Counts, rispettivamente, della condivisione file per l'elaborazione.
Target | Microsoft.SystemCenter.ManagementServer | ||
Category | Alert | ||
Enabled | True | ||
Alert Generate | True | ||
Alert Severity | Warning | ||
Alert Priority | Normal | ||
Remotable | True | ||
Alert Message |
|
ID | Module Type | TypeId | RunAs |
---|---|---|---|
DS | DataSource | Microsoft.SystemCenter.CM.AEM.AlertModule | Default |
GenerateAlert | WriteAction | System.Health.GenerateAlert | Default |
<Rule ID="Microsoft.SystemCenter.CM.AEM.ParameterProcessingError.Alert" Enabled="true" Target="SCLibrary!Microsoft.SystemCenter.ManagementServer" ConfirmDelivery="true" Remotable="true" Priority="Normal" DiscardLevel="100">
<Category>Alert</Category>
<DataSources>
<DataSource ID="DS" TypeID="Microsoft.SystemCenter.CM.AEM.AlertModule">
<EventNumber>10923</EventNumber>
<ManagementGroupName>$Target/ManagementGroup/Name$</ManagementGroupName>
</DataSource>
</DataSources>
<WriteActions>
<WriteAction ID="GenerateAlert" TypeID="Health!System.Health.GenerateAlert">
<Priority>1</Priority>
<Severity>1</Severity>
<AlertName/>
<AlertDescription/>
<AlertMessageId>$MPElement[Name='Microsoft.SystemCenter.CM.AEM.ParameterProcessingError.Alert.AlertMessage']$</AlertMessageId>
<AlertParameters>
<AlertParameter1>$Data/EventDescription$</AlertParameter1>
</AlertParameters>
<Suppression>
<SuppressionValue/>
</Suppression>
</WriteAction>
</WriteActions>
</Rule>